Thanks, Arno.
Here's what I notice.
Subject 2 has the following number of events, as indexed by "cell2mat({EEG.event.type})":
1 has 181 events (stimulus onset, Easy Trial)
2 has 149 events (stimulus onset, Hard Trial)
3 has 152 events (Correct Response, Easy)
4 has 141 events (Correct Response, Hard)
9 has 19 events (Incorrect Response, Easy)
10 has 21 events (Incorrect Response, Hard)
254 has 1 events (Start task code)
This is a basic Flankers task with 2 events per trial (stimulus onset and the subject response) and 330 trials.
After running EEG = clean_artifacts(EEG,'FlatlineCriterion',5,'ChannelCriterion',0.8,'LineNoiseCriterion',4,'Highpass',[0.25 0.75],'BurstCriterion',10,'Distance','Euclidian','WindowCriterionTolerances',[-Inf 7]), the events count will match the original file's events count.
If I run the full clean_artifacts function from the GUI with BurstRejection 'On' and Window Criterion set to 0.25), then the events are converted to cell arrays, probably because of 'boundary'. In any case, I can only count the events using '{ EEG.event.type }':
1 has 180 events
10 has 5 events
2 has 134 events
3 has 82 events
4 has 87 events
9 has 6 events
boundary has 345 events
Thus, the full default clean_artifacts removed a large portion of subject response codes without removing many stimulus codes, but also added a tremendous number of "boundary" event flags. Using a more lax or more aggressive value for Window Criterion does not help the situation.
Data is collected with a Biosemi system and 34 channels of EEG plus VEGO+, VEGO-, HEOG+, HEOG-, Mastoid 1, Mastoid 2. I’m using eeglab2019b on Matlab 9.7.0.1190202, 64-bit.
